Output 8886253c72ec1ce4130998d0d05dd295daab5d71680907b28eca47f960d124bd:1

value
105000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ebb308bc88d6b57eab0255b8ff6bfdad74ce601b OP_EQUAL
address
3PBHC8g3UECt8fwxj3csg12Z6QidTpcx9w
transaction
8886253c72ec1ce4130998d0d05dd295daab5d71680907b28eca47f960d124bd
spent
true